Some, tired of honest service; these, outdone,

Disgusted therefore, or appalled, by aims

Of fiercer zealots—so confusion reigned,

And the more faithful were compelled to exclaim,

As Brutus did to Virtue, 'Liberty,

I worshipped thee, and find thee but a Shade!'[DO]

"Such recantation had for me no charm,

Nor would I bend to it; who should have grieved

At aught, however fair, that[268] bore the mien

Of a conclusion, or catastrophe.
